Health

Yorkshire Terriers are full of energy and require regular exercise. They are also susceptible to joint and dental issues, requiring routine veterinary care. Additionally, these dogs have a long-haired coat that requires frequent grooming. Yorkies can be costly to keep.

The cost of a Yorkie is affected by several factors, including pedigree and color. Breeders with a good reputation who conduct health testing and raise their pups in a healthy environment generally charge more than breeders who do not. In addition, the cost of puppies can be higher in areas with more expensive housing costs.

Yorkies are small dogs that may suffer from hypoglycemia. This condition can lead to weakness and lethargy and could require urgent veterinary treatment. Furthermore, Teacup Yorkies are prone to dental diseases because of their small mouths. This can result in infection, deterioration of the jaw bone and tooth loss. To prevent this from happening owners should brush their dogs' teeth every day using a special toothpaste for pets. Regular veterinary oral examinations and cleanings are also recommended to eliminate plaque and tartar before they cause gum disease.

Yorkies are energetic and confident dogs despite their small size. They tend to be gentle with children and other animals, however the supervision of an adult is recommended for children under the age of. This breed is a good option for apartment living as it can be adapted to smaller spaces and does not bark excessively.

As with any dog, Yorkies need to be vaccinated and treated for parasites on a regular basis. A preventative approach to vet care is the best method to keep your dog happy and healthy. Following the advice of your vet and investing in a responsible breeder will help you avoid many common diseases and improve the overall health of your dog. A simple medical exam or blood test can screen for most hereditary conditions like hypothyroidism. Furthermore, hereditary diseases that affect eyes, like cherry eye, can be prevented by limiting breeding to dogs who are healthy and free of this condition.

Training

The small size of the Yorkshire Terrier and its high energy level will force you to take extra care of them in the initial months, weeks, and years of life. This breed is at risk of injury from jumping off of (relatively high) furniture. It's crucial to ensure your home is puppy-proofed.

It's not enough to keep your home secure from dangers such as sharp objects. You must also offer a safe place for your dog to rest. A crate is a wonderful place for a Cayden yorkshire kaufen​ Terrier to sleep and call "home," especially during prolonged periods when you'll be gone from home.

Crate training can be important in introducing your puppy to other people so that he is well-adjusted to different environments and situations. Begin socialization early and after obtaining the approval of your vet introduce your puppy to a wide variety of animals, people and sounds in a safe, controlled setting.

Your puppy should be fed a high-quality diet that emphasizes natural ingredients and avoids artificial additives. A majority of pet food brands contain colorants as well as flavor enhancers and chemical preservatives which can cause allergies in puppies. Select a kibble made of whole meat as its primary ingredient. Avoid any fillers such as wheat, corn or soy.

In addition to a premium diet, it's important to give your puppy clean water. Bottled spring water or water that has been filtered are better than tap water. Tap water contains chlorine and chemicals that could cause stomach irritations in small breeds. There is a wide range of water filtration products on the market, from compact hand-held pitchers to complete under-sink solutions.
